Discover Big Knife Provincial Park: A Hiker's Haven in the Canadian Rockies

Welcome to big knife provincial park, a hidden gem nestled within the breathtaking landscapes of the Canadian Rockies. If you're a hiker, outdoor enthusiast, or simply someone who cherishes spending time in nature, this park is your perfect escape.

A Natural Wonderland Awaits

big knife provincial park offers an authentic wilderness experience that captures the essence of the Canadian Rockies. With its lush forests, rolling hills, and serene riverbanks, it's a place where you can truly connect with nature. The park spans over 2,000 hectares, providing ample space for exploration and adventure.

Hiking Trails for Every Adventurer

Whether you're a seasoned hiker or just starting out, Big Knife has trails that cater to all levels of experience. The park features several well-maintained paths that wind through diverse terrains. As you hike, you'll be treated to stunning vistas of the surrounding mountains and valleys. Keep your eyes peeled for local wildlife—deer, moose, and various bird species are often spotted along the trails.

Activities Beyond Hiking

While hiking is a highlight at big knife provincial park, there's more to enjoy. The Battle River runs through the park, offering opportunities for canoeing and fishing. Bring your binoculars for birdwatching or pack a picnic to savor by the water's edge. In winter months, snowshoeing transforms the landscape into a snowy wonderland.

Plan Your Visit

big knife provincial park is accessible year-round and provides basic amenities such as picnic areas and restrooms. Remember to pack essentials like water, snacks, and appropriate clothing for changing weather conditions. Whether you're planning a day trip or an extended stay at one of the nearby campgrounds, this park promises an unforgettable outdoor experience.
